2014 Elementary School FLL Rookie Grant Application Procedure

The FIRST in Michigan Elementary School FLL Rookie Grants are made possible by the generous support of General Motors.  The grant amount is $300.  These are reimbursement grants. 

Teams can apply for these grants after registering for the 2014 season with FIRST FLL and purchasing their kit of parts. Registration and kit order can be done via the FIRST Lego League Team Information and Management (TIMS) website (https://my.usfirst.org/fll/tims/site.lasso).  (Note:  You will not be able to purchase your kit until you have completed the registration process.)

The FIRST in Michigan Elementary School FLL Rookie Grant amount is $300.  The first 100 teams that apply and meet the criteria will be approved.  Once approved, teams will receive a single check for $300 from FIRST in Michigan.

FIRST in Michigan criteria:

  1. WHO MAY APPLY:
  1. Any rookie Michigan FLL team comprised of elementary school aged team members from Michigan may apply for  this grant.
  2. Multiple teams from one school/organization:
  1. If your school/organization did not participate in the last two years, each of the teams you register this season may apply for a grant.
  2. If your school/organization participated in FLL in the last two seasons, and the number of registered teams from your school/organization this season will exceed the highest number of teams registered in either of the last two seasons - the additional teams may each apply for a grant. 

  1. WHEN TO APPLY:  
     All of the following must have occurred before an application can be submitted:
  1. The team is registered for the 2014 season on the FIRST Lego League Team Information and Management (TIMS) website (https://my.usfirst.org/fll/tims/site.lasso).
  2. The team has a permanent team number. Applications with temporary team numbers will not be processed.
  3. The team has purchased its kit of parts, and received a proof of purchase confirmation/receipt by email, and has forwarded the confirmation/receipt email to michiganfll@gmail.com along with the team’s permanent team number.

  1. TERMS OF THE GRANT:

Any team that receives a grant is required to build a robot from the kit of parts and participate in one official FIRST in Michigan FLL Qualifier Event during November or December.  If the team fails to comply, they must return their full kit to FIRST in Michigan or reimburse FIRST in Michigan the full amount of the grant.  Clicking “YES” on the grant form under the TERMS of the GRANT signifies the team’s full acceptance of the terms.

  1. TIMING:

Teams approved for grants will receive a check as soon as completion of team registration is verified and kit of parts proof of purchase is received.
